我想制作一个由 Ubuntu(无图形界面)框支持的警报系统,它通过命令行播放各种公告和警报音轨(.mp3 或 .wav)。
例如:
$ root> audioplay ./hello.wav
Run Code Online (Sandbox Code Playgroud)
音频应该来自 PC 音频插孔。我也可能用另一个套接字侦听器(例如 Ruby Sinatra)包装它。
我怎样才能做到这一点?
我有一对Acoustic CHP600BT Solutions 蓝牙耳机 - 黑色的音质问题。
当我将这些耳机连接到我的手机 (Samsung S2 plus) 时,音质是完美的,但是当连接到我的笔记本电脑时,音质很差,并且带有静电。
我使用 Windows 7 旗舰版。我重新安装了所有驱动程序并在谷歌上搜索了问题,但什么也没找到。
我有一个外部音频接口(M-audio fast track c400)。为了让我的 macbook 识别它(在音频/midi 设置中显示),我必须重新启动,这很麻烦。我有其他的 m-audio 接口在连接时自动检测到,我很确定这个应该是一样的。互联网上的大多数帖子都建议更新设备的操作系统或软件/固件。我已经完成了所有这些,但没有运气。我目前运行的是 OS X 10.8.5。
有没有办法强制 OS X 重新加载设备?最好是一些命令行巫毒,我可以在需要时快速启动,或者用一个漂亮的小 shell 脚本包装。
现在问题似乎已解决...我不确定以下如何解决问题。如果你知道,请评论!
受到@sbugert 回答的启发,我开始研究其他系统守护进程,如果重新启动,它们可能会起作用。作为在黑暗中的一枪我杀了coreservicesd。这导致操作系统变得明显不稳定,我最终被自动注销。令我惊讶的是,当我重新登录时,我的音频接口被识别出来了。
基于此,我假设杀死coreservicesd和注销/登录可能是一种可能的(丑陋的)解决方法。于是我把接口拔掉再插回去,果然不出所料。于是我杀了coreservicesd,尝试注销,但是由于杀了coreservicesd导致系统不稳定,无法让系统注销。我最终被迫“硬”关机(即按住电源按钮直到它关闭)。再次启动 macbook 后,现在每次插入时都会自动识别该界面。我怀疑这个“硬”重置可能已经解决了问题,而没有使用 coreservices 守护程序的所有恶作剧,但我无法测试.
如果有人可以阐明这一点,请做!
我一遍又一遍地搜索,但找不到对“hw:0,0”含义的任何解释。如何确定我的 USB 声卡的编号? MPD要求我输入如下内容:
audio_output {
type "alsa"
name "Sound Card"
device "hw:0,0" # optional
format "44100:16:2" # optional
}
Run Code Online (Sandbox Code Playgroud)
如果我执行“alsamixer -c 1”,它会打开 USB 卡的音量控制,但这对我没有帮助。
在哪里可以找到系统上的设备名称/编号列表?它们对硬件变化有弹性吗?如果我移除卡 2,卡 3 会变成卡 2 吗?还有其他方法可以识别设备吗?我在哪里可以找到有关这些的文档?
我最近从 Win 7 64 位升级到 Windows 8,并开始遇到一个奇怪的问题。当我运行任何播放声音的程序(例如游戏或 Spotify)时,在随机间隔(通常大约 5-10 分钟)之后,程序声音会设置得非常低。
如果我 Alt-Tab 到桌面并检查混音器,我可以看到应用程序音量已自动设置得很低 - 其他音量级别(即设备扬声器)保持不变。我可以将应用程序音量设置回合理的水平,然后再保持这种状态 5 到 10 分钟,然后再次安静下来。
我的声音是 Realtek High Definition Audio,我的机器是 Acer Aspire 5738G,如果有任何帮助的话。
非常感谢任何帮助!
我有一大堆音频文件(大约 1000 个),我想将它们从 m4a 转换为 mp3,这样我就可以在带有 USB 端口的 CD 播放器上播放它们。
我尝试做一些简单的事情,例如:ffmpeg -i FILE.m4a FILE.mp3但这似乎将比特率降低到非常低的值,这不是我想要的。
同样,我不想使用恒定比特率(例如 320k)进行转换,因为我正在转换的某些文件是 320k m4a,而有些文件的质量与 96k m4a 一样低。
强制 320k 似乎没有意义,因为某些文件会变得比它们需要的大很多倍。同样,通过将我所有的 320k 文件转换为远低于 96k 的文件来销毁它们也是没有意义的。(目前,文件正在转换为大约 50k。)
有谁知道我怎么能做到这一点?我真正想做的是告诉 ffmpeg 将目录中的所有 m4a 文件转换为 mp3,同时尽可能保留当前的音频质量。(当然,从有损文件格式转换为有损文件格式可能会产生一些额外的损失。)
谢谢你的帮助。如果这是不可能的,是否有某种脚本可以在单独转换文件时检测到所需的质量?
PS:我正在使用英特尔 Mac,但也有一个 Ubuntu 盒子。
任何人都知道如何设置应用程序以将其音频输出到 Windows 中的特定设备?我正在处理无法进入其设置并选择要使用的输出设备的应用程序。
我最近进行了从 Vista 到 Windows 7 RTM 的就地升级。在大多数情况下,事情进展得很顺利。我遇到的唯一问题是我的蓝牙耳机 Dell BH200。笔记本电脑是 Inspiron 1720。
我可以让 Windows 7 与耳机配对,甚至可以让蓝牙设置显示有立体声音频可用。问题是蓝牙耳机从未出现在我的声音输出设备列表中。我已经卸载并重新安装了戴尔的蓝牙驱动程序,尝试打开/关闭耳机的所有功能,删除蓝牙驱动程序并让 Windows 重新检测和安装,但到目前为止没有任何效果。
我想我应该提到耳机在 Vista 中运行良好。我怎样才能让它工作?
这真是一个奇怪的问题。当我关闭笔记本电脑(我在扩展坞上使用它;发生此问题时它不会离开扩展坞)或当我打开 iTunes 时,机器上的音量输出下降。
不是 Windows 音量栏本身。那保持不变。但是程序输出的音量(如 Winamp,但它也发生在游戏中,所以它不是特定于应用程序的)下降。不是这些应用程序的音量控制,而是输出音量下降。
快速重启安静的应用程序解决了这个问题。但每次我关闭笔记本电脑或打开 iTunes时都会发生这种情况。
这很奇怪,我很难过。有任何想法吗?
今天我安装了 Windows 10,我喜欢它,除了这个错误:
卷有一个错误。当我在 Microsoft Edge 上观看 YouTube 视频并单击 时next video,我的耳朵会被吹掉,因为出于某种原因,音量一直保持在 100%,直到我使用键盘上的功能键对其进行调整。然后它说它是 30%,然后音频突然跳回到 30%。这主要发生在 Edge 上,因为 Edge 在我的音量混音器中没有位置,所以那里发生了一些时髦的事情。
每次 Edge 加载新的视频或音频元素时,音量都会跳到 100%,有时当我在选项卡之间切换时,它也会这样做。
我也有 Windows 通知声音在音量混合器中跳到 100%。这非常令人沮丧,因为我有时会使用录音室监视器,并且因为错误而受到打击只是愚蠢的。
Windows 10 中的音量是否存在任何已知问题?
我还应该提一下,音量设置中没有耳机设备,升级之前就有。